The Impact of the Pandemic on Retirement Planning
Data is in favor of lump sum investing, no matter how you slice it up. It's a bottom line. It's not compelling to dollar cost average. Alexandra McQueen thinks COVID-19 will actually increase the interest in the annuity business.

We then turn our attention to the core topic of the show, dollar-cost averaging versus lump-sum investing. Ben presents an overview of dollar-cost averaging along with some of the perceived benefits. We dive into his analysis of dollar-cost averaging versus lump sum investing in equity portfolios over select 10-year periods across various countries. We discuss the results based on a range of factors and variables. The crux of the argument is that dollar-cost averaging is not as compelling as it’s often sold to be. While there are psychological benefits, the empirical evidence shows that there are not real ones.
